Original Description
Monastir by Edward Lear invites viewers into a sun-drenched Mediterranean landscape, where the golden hues of ancient architecture blend seamlessly with the azure sky. Painted in 1848 during Lear’s travels through the Balkans, this watercolor captures the fortified town of Monastir (modern-day Bitola, North Macedonia) with a poetic sensitivity characteristic of his topographical works. Lear, renowned as both a landscape painter and nonsense poet, imbues the scene with a delicate balance of precision and romanticism—his loose yet controlled brushstrokes evoke the warmth of the region, while the meticulous detailing of the fortress and distant mountains grounds the composition in reality. Though lesser-known than his contemporaries like Turner, Lear’s works occupy a unique niche in 19th-century art, bridging documentary accuracy with lyrical atmosphere. Monastir exemplifies his ability to transform travel sketches into enduring visual narratives, offering a window into a vanishing world of Ottoman-era tranquility.
